Zachary Ty Nalley
October 3, 2003 - May 27, 2022
Rock Hill, South Carolina - Zachary Ty Nalley was born October 3, 2003 in Rock Hill, SC to Buford Wydale Nalley and Carrie Leanne Foster. Zach walked into the loving arms of his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, on May 27, 2022 at the age of 18.
Zach was kind, softly spoken and an old soul. He always cared about everyone else around him and he was fascinated by nature. Zachary attended York Preparatory Academy and was employed at Chick-fil-A in Rock Hill where he moved up quickly into a team lead position. He was a hard worker and excelled in school. He graduated May 26, 2022 on the A honor roll.
Zach was blessed with a large and loving family. He is survived by his father and stepmother Dale Nalley and Kassey Evans of the home, his mother Carrie Foster and stepfather Chad Foster. His siblings Dezaray and fiance Joseph Sherwood, Kolby, Amber, Chandler, Alexis, Raydin, and his nephew Myles. He leaves his grandparents, Renee and Tommy Craig, Buford Nalley, Robert and Rhonda Evans, Debbie Nalley, and his maternal grandmother. He was preceded in death by his maternal grandfather Charles Ansell and his great grandparents Charles and Raye Hinson. He is also survived by his aunts and uncles, TJ Craig and Krystal Lyons, cousin Kye, Shane and Stephanie Helms, cousins Bailey, Colby and Riley as well as numerous other aunts, uncles and cousins.
Zachary will be greatly missed by everyone that knew him. He was the kind of young man that anyone would be proud to call son, grandson, nephew, cousin and friend.
